On the SU(1,1) Thermal Group of Bosonic Strings and D-Branes
Abstract
All possible Bogoliubov operators that generate the thermal transformations in the Thermo Field Dynamics (TFD) form a SU(1,1) group. We discuss this contruction in the bosonic string theory. In particular, the transformation of the Fock space and string operators generated by the most general SU(1,1) unitary Bogoliubov transformation and the entropy of the corresponding thermal string are computed. Also, we construct the thermal $D$-brane solution generated by the SU(1,1) transformation in a constant Kalb-Ramond field and compute its entropy.
